Clarify Key Concepts in Personal Injury Law

, often referred to as tort law, involves legal disputes where individuals claim to have suffered injuries due to someone else's negligence or wrongful actions. Understanding this area is crucial, especially for those who have been affected.

Negligence is a key concept here. It means failing to exercise reasonable care, leading to injury or damage to another person. Recognizing negligence is vital, as it forms the basis of most personal injury claims. Imagine the distress of being hurt because someone didn’t take the necessary precautions. It’s not just about the injury; it’s about the impact it takes on victims and their families.

Then there's the duty of care. This legal obligation requires individuals to act in a way that protects others from harm. For example, drivers must operate their vehicles safely to safeguard pedestrians and fellow road users. Acknowledging this duty is essential in determining who is liable when accidents occur. It’s about understanding that our actions can significantly impact others’ lives.

Causation is another critical element. It’s about proving a direct link between the defendant's actions and the harm suffered. Courts often ask plaintiffs to show how the defendant's actions led to their injuries, which can be challenging, especially when multiple factors are involved. Clear causation is necessary to support a claim, and it can be overwhelming to navigate this process alone.

Finally, we have damages. This term refers to the compensation sought for losses, including medical expenses, lost wages, and emotional suffering. Knowing the types of damages can help victims assess the value of their claims. It’s not just about financial compensation; it’s about acknowledging the pain and hardship endured.

Explore Common Types of Personal Injury Cases

can arise from various incidents, each carrying its own emotional weight and legal complexities. Let’s explore some common types:

  1. Vehicle accidents: These often involve collisions between vehicles-cars, trucks, or motorcycles-frequently due to negligence, distracted driving, or impaired driving. In New York, vehicle accidents are a significant contributor to injuries, highlighting the urgent need for legal representation to navigate the intricate issues of liability. Victims may feel overwhelmed, but understanding their rights is the first step toward healing.
  2. Slip and fall accidents: Injuries that occur on someone else's property due to unsafe conditions, like wet floors or uneven surfaces, are all too common. In New York City alone, around 16,000 sidewalk accidents happen each year, leading to an estimated $890 million in direct medical costs. While proper maintenance and safety measures can prevent many of these incidents, they remain a leading cause of personal injury claims. It’s crucial for victims to know they’re not alone and that help is available.
  3. Rideshare accidents: When rideshare services like Uber or Lyft are involved, determining liability can be particularly challenging, as multiple parties may be implicated. Victims navigating these complexities deserve compassionate guidance to ensure they receive the support needed to recover.
  4. Construction accidents: Accidents on construction sites often arise from unsafe practices or equipment failures. The construction industry sees a staggering rate of 34,000 incidents per 100,000 workers each year, underscoring the importance of safety measures and advocacy for injured workers. Those affected should know that their voices matter and that support is available to help them through this tough time.
  5. Medical malpractice: These cases occur when healthcare professionals fail to meet the standard of care, resulting in harm to patients. Victims of medical malpractice face complex legal challenges, making expert advice essential. It’s vital for them to understand that se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ness.

Navigate the Process of Filing a Personal Injury Claim

Filing a personal injury claim can feel overwhelming, but understanding the process can make a significant difference in your journey toward healing and justice:

  1. Seek medical attention: Your health should always come first. Getting the medical care you need not only aids in your recovery but also establishes a vital record of your injuries. This documentation is crucial for your case, providing the foundation for your claim.
  2. Document the incident: Gathering evidence is key to supporting your claim. Take photographs of the scene, collect witness statements, and obtain police reports. The more thorough your documentation, the stronger your case will be. Remember, situations backed by solid evidence often lead to more favorable outcomes.
  3. Find an attorney: Finding a qualified attorney can be a game-changer. They can assess your case and guide you through the legal maze. An experienced attorney brings valuable insights and can help you navigate the complexities of personal injury law, ensuring you feel supported every step of the way.
  4. File a request: When you're ready, submit your request to the appropriate insurance company. Be sure to detail the incident and the damages you've incurred. Including all relevant information is essential to avoid any delays in processing your request, allowing you to focus on your recovery.
  5. Negotiate a settlement: Collaborate closely with your attorney to negotiate with the insurance company. This step is crucial, as about 95-96% of personal injury cases settle outside of court. Your negotiation skills, supported by your attorney, can help you receive what you truly deserve.
  6. Litigation (if necessary): If a settlement can't be reached, your attorney may need to file a lawsuit to pursue your case in court. While litigation can be a lengthy process, it may be necessary to ensure you receive just compensation for your suffering.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is personal injury law?

Personal injury law, also known as tort law, involves legal disputes where individuals claim to have suffered due to someone else's negligence or wrongful actions.

What does negligence mean in personal injury law?

Negligence refers to failing to exercise reasonable care, which leads to injury or damage to another person. It is a key concept that forms the basis of most personal injury claims.

What is the Duty of Care?

The Duty of Care is a legal obligation that requires individuals to act in a way that protects others from harm. For instance, drivers must operate their vehicles safely to ensure the safety of pedestrians and other road users.

What is causation in personal injury claims?

Causation involves proving a direct link between the negligent act and the harm suffered. Plaintiffs must demonstrate how the defendant's actions led to their injuries, which can be complex when multiple factors are at play.

What are damages in the context of personal injury law?

Damages refer to the compensation sought for losses incurred, such as medical bills, lost wages, and emotional suffering. Understanding the types of damages available can help victims evaluate the value of their claims.
